If it is necessary to prevent the rudder from moving while a repair is made on the steering system using the illustrated actuator __________. GS-0116

Correct Answer: Option C — secure the valves in the supply and return lines

To safely perform maintenance on a steering gear actuator, the hydraulic system must be isolated. Securing the supply and return valves prevents hydraulic fluid movement, effectively locking the rudder in position. This is a standard safety procedure to prevent accidental rudder movement while personnel are working on the steering gear.
